Helen Wilson

 With heavy hearts Helen’s family announces her peaceful passing on Wednesday, December 2, 2020 at the age of 96, at the Bethany Care Center in Airdrie, Alberta.

 Helen was the firstborn child of Henry and Veda Olson on March 6, 1924 where they lived in Craik, Saskatchewan. She married Robert (Bob) Wilson, residing in Flin Flon, Swan River and Winnipeg, Manitoba for many years. From there they moved to Edmonton, later settling in Airdrie, Alberta. 

 Helen was a caring mother who loved spending time with her family, celebrating special occasions, cooking meals and baking goodies loved by everyone. Helen loved children, especially babies, devoting many years of her life working in childcare. Throughout her life, she was a very active and social person which continued into her retirement years, everyday going for coffee with her many friends.

 Left to cherish her memory are her children, Donna (Jack) Lumax, Keith (Winnie) Wilson, Judy (Bill) Barevich, Doug (Mary) Wilson; as well as, her many grandchildren, great-grandchildren and great-great grandchildren; sisters, Gladys Doud and Darlene (Bill) McEwen; sister-in-law, Edna Olson, Anne Olson and Betty Hayes.

She was predeceased by her husband, Robert (Bob) Wilson; son, William (Billy) Wilson; brothers, Vernon Olson and Elmer Olson.

 The family would like to send a heartfelt thank you to the staff at Bethany Care Center in Airdrie for their kind and professional care to Helen in her final days.

 Due to COVID concerns the family will be having a Memorial and Internment Service in Swan River, Manitoba in safer times.

 In lieu of flowers, donations can be made to the Royal Canadian Legion Poppy Fund, Branch 288 in Airdrie, AB or Branch 39 in Swan River, MB.
